“African peace” opens the door for Sudan’s return and raises widespread criticism

The statement stressed the importance of preserving Sudanese state institutions, and condemned the violence, clashes and the unprecedented humanitarian catastrophe in Darfur He called for the urgent lifting of the siege on the city of El Fasher and ensuring the arrival of humanitarian aid.

The statement urged the warring parties to cease-fire And implement the agreements reached in the Jeddah Declaration regarding humanitarian access, protection of civilians, and withdrawal from civilian homes and buildings.

Observers and politicians criticized what they called “ignoring” the foundations of the Sudanese crisis in the Peace Council’s statement regarding the results of its delegation’s visit to Port Sudan during the first week of October.

According to observers, the statement adopted by the Council regarding the report of the field mission to Port Sudan on the third and fourth of October, ignored the major violations resulting from the air attacks that led to the death of thousands of civilians since the outbreak of fighting in mid-April 2023, and gave legitimacy to the army commander. Abdel Fattah Al-Burhan It gives him the green light to form a civilian government.

Bakri Al-Jak, spokesman for the Civil Forces Coordination “Taqaddam,” said that the Peace Council’s statement departed from neutrality and gave the armed forces the upper hand in any political arrangements.

Al-Jak explained to Sky News Arabia: “This is an attempt to normalize the Port Sudan authority as an authority with absolute right to act, in contrast to the report of the fact-finding committee of the Human Rights Council.”

He added: “In light of the current composition of the Council, it is not surprising that there is an attempt to legitimize the de facto authority, and it is expected that this step will be portrayed to help the African Union have the ability to communicate with a wide spectrum of Sudanese to know what they want, but the truth is that any presence of the African Union In Port Sudan, it will only be to hear the narrative of the de facto authority and elements of the former regime.”

For his part, researcher and academic Al-Amin Mukhtar points out that the statement did not mention the violations committed by the army, whether with regard to aircraft bombing or arrests carried out on the basis of identity and political affiliation.

Mukhtar told Sky News Arabia: “The statement proved that… African Peace and Security Council He was immersed in flattery and weakness, blatantly sided with the army and treated as if there was a popular civilian authority elected or representing the people.”

He pointed out that the statement “did not specify the mechanisms for proposing peaceful solutions, nor pressure cards on the belligerents,” adding, “This position will complicate resolving the crisis and open the door to fueling regional and international conflicts.”

Mukhtar criticized the talk about returns Sudan The African Union, despite the fact that there are no reasons for freezing its membership in the Union.
